American parents have registered 1,216 Jhonatans since 1880, against 22 Jhonaels. Jhonatan is still ahead, with 28 babies in 2025.

Who was ahead

Jhonatan has been the commoner name in every year either was published, 1986 to 2025. The lead has never changed hands.

The closest they came was 2017, when Jhonael had 6 and Jhonatan had 13.

Which name is older

Half of the Jhonatans alive today are over 18; half the Jhonaels are over 8. That is 10 years between them: two names in use at the same time, worn by two different generations.
